La Quinta's real estate sector is among the most technology-intensive in the valley, with brokerages managing luxury listings that require high-resolution virtual tours, drone photography storage, secure document signing platforms, and CRM systems that track high-value client relationships over months or years. Property management firms overseeing vacation rentals in PGA West and surrounding communities need always-on connectivity to smart home systems, keyless entry platforms, and guest communication tools that operate around the clock.
The professional services corridor along Highway 111 and within the La Quinta Business Park has quietly become one of the east valley's densest concentrations of knowledge workers. CPAs, financial advisors, insurance brokers, and consulting firms in this area handle client data that falls under various regulatory requirements, from tax record retention rules to insurance industry data protection standards. These firms need IT infrastructure that meets compliance benchmarks while remaining intuitive enough for staff who aren't technology experts.

Common IT Problems La Quinta Businesses Face
Securing Luxury Real Estate Data and Client Privacy
La Quinta real estate firms handle transaction details, financial documents, and personal information for high-net-worth clients who expect absolute discretion. A data breach exposing a celebrity client's home purchase or a wealthy buyer's financial records would be devastating to a brokerage's reputation. These firms need encryption, access controls, and monitoring that matches the sensitivity of the data they handle.
Delivering Consistent Guest Experiences Across Vacation Rental Portfolios
Property management companies in La Quinta often manage dozens of vacation rentals across PGA West, The Quarry, and other communities, each needing reliable smart home technology, guest Wi-Fi, and keyless entry systems. When a guest can't get into a property at 10 PM because the smart lock lost connectivity, it becomes an IT emergency. Managing technology across a distributed portfolio of properties requires centralized monitoring and rapid response.
Balancing Seasonal Business Fluctuations with IT Costs
Many La Quinta businesses see dramatic revenue swings between the busy winter season and quieter summer months. Staffing and technology costs need to flex accordingly, but most traditional IT contracts don't account for seasonality. A managed services model with scalable support tiers helps La Quinta businesses maintain coverage year-round without overpaying during the off-season.
Professional Firms Outgrowing Consumer-Grade Technology
Many professional services firms in La Quinta started with consumer routers, personal email accounts, and basic file sharing when they were small. As they've grown to 10 or 20 employees, these consumer-grade solutions create performance bottlenecks, security gaps, and collaboration headaches. Transitioning to business-grade infrastructure without disrupting active client work requires a methodical migration approach.

We work with resorts, boutique hotels, and vacation rental management companies throughout La Quinta. These businesses need guest Wi-Fi networks separated from internal operations, reliable booking platform connectivity, and AV systems for event spaces. We design hospitality networks that deliver the seamless guest experience La Quinta visitors expect while keeping your business data secure behind the scenes.
The business park area is one of our most active service zones. We support CPAs, insurance agencies, financial planners, and consulting firms with managed IT that includes cloud-based practice management tools, secure client portals, encrypted email, and reliable backups. These firms handle sensitive client data every day, and we build IT environments that protect it without slowing their teams down.
Real estate professionals in La Quinta spend most of their time at showings, open houses, and client meetings — not sitting at a desk. We set up secure mobile access to your MLS tools, transaction management platforms, and client documents so your team can work from anywhere in the valley. We also manage device security for laptops and phones that travel between properties, coffee shops, and home offices.
